Hi, I am unable to apply landscape wallpapers and portrait wallpapers separately. I keep seeing wallpapers on this forum, and they have one dedicated for landscape and portrait. However, I can only apply portrait wallpaper or landscape. It's one or the other.

How do I fix this? How do I apply both wallpapers?

There are 2 ways.
1; There are two files in your Windows direcory on the X1, stwater_480_800.jpg and stwater_800_480.jpg. These are the background files, all you have to do is change them.
2. I have made some 800x800 wallpapers to work great in both modes :) I'm also very picky so I haven't manipulated a lot of pictures for it yet...
